Summary
A vulnerability described as critical has been identified in IBM DB2 and DB2 Connect Server up to 11.1.4.7/11.5.9/12.1.1. Affected by this vulnerability is an unknown functionality of the component Query Handler. Such manipulation leads to stack-based overflow. This vulnerability is traded as CVE-2024-49350. The attack may be launched remotely. There is no exploit available. Upgrading the affected component is recommended.
Details
A vulnerability, which was classified as critical, has been found in IBM DB2 and DB2 Connect Server up to 11.1.4.7/11.5.9/12.1.1. Affected by this issue is an unknown code block of the component Query Handler.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a stack-based overflow vulnerability. Using CWE to declare the problem leads to CWE-121. A stack-based buffer overflow condition is a condition where the buffer being overwritten is allocated on the stack (i.e., is a local variable or, rarely, a parameter to a function). Impacted is confidentiality, integrity, and availability. CVE summarizes:
IBM Db2 for Linux, UNIX and Windows (includes DB2 Connect Server) 11.1.0 through 11.1.4.7, 11.5.0 through 11.5.9 and 12.1.0 through 12.1.1 is vulnerable to a denial of service as the server may crash under certain conditions with a specially crafted query.
The advisory is available at ibm.com. This vulnerability is handled as CVE-2024-49350 since 10/14/2024. The exploitation is known to be easy. The attack may be launched remotely. The technical details are unknown and an exploit is not available. The structure of the vulnerability defines a possible price range of USD $0-$5k at the moment (estimation calculated on 01/23/2026).
Upgrading eliminates this vulnerability.
